Angus Wilson Photographs. Vols. xix-xxix. Unmounted photographs, with a few unused postcards; 1883-1999, n.d. Partly annotated. Eleven volumes. British Library arrangement as follows:
Angus Wilson Photographs. Vol. xx. Grandparents, parents, brothers, Frederick, Winn, Clive, Colin, Patrick and family groups including Angus as a child and adolescent; 1883-1930s.
Angus Wilson Photographs. Vol. xxi. Two sets of enhanced copies of selected items from the preceding two volumes, followed by photographs of Angus Wilson as an adult and with nieces, nephews, etc.;1940s-1990.
